Nettet2. apr. 2024 · Double-click the Disk Utility application. In Disk Utility, select your Mac’s internal drive (or an internal SSD). You should see two options: First Aid or Partition. Click Partition. Click the ‘+’ below Partition Layout. Now a new Partition will appear, and you can change the size according to what you need. NettetDefrag was necessary for HDDs because HDD performance relied heavily on collocation of data, this is not an issue with SSDs because there are no moving parts. Linux filesystems (ext4 etc) are also less prone to fragmentation in the first place, defragmentation is mostly a windows specific phenomenon. NO! SSDs don't store data like HDDs.
